The John Snow Society aims to promote the life and works of Dr John Snow, the pioneer of epidemiological method and celebrated anaesthetist.

Did US #covid19 mask mandates work 🧐?
Using data from over 34,000 people in the weeks before and after mandates, authors use #interruptedtimeseries approaches and show that as a behaviour change mechanism, mandates might need some work...

Prof Patricia Bath's (1942-2019) groundbreaking work in #opthalmology pushed for better research and treatment options for black people with sight conditions - in whom she and others demonstrated were already at higher risk of #blindness 👇

Professor Toyin Togun of the @lshtm.bsky.social is leading critical work on the development of a unique biosignature to distinguish childhood #TB from other diseases.
